This is a PCI bus-compatible 4-axis motion control board. Evolved from the reliable "X3203A" to be faster and more compact, it features the original high-speed S-curve acceleration/deceleration pulse generator "X7043." It is capable of controlling pulse input type servo motors and stepping motors. ■ Maximum output pulse rate: 4.8MHz ■ Positioning drive, continuous drive, home return drive, sensor positioning drive ■ Independent control of 4 axes and linear interpolation control ■ Synchronous start function ■ Linear acceleration/deceleration / S-curve acceleration/deceleration (sine, parabola) ■ Automatic calculation of deceleration start point / manual setting ■ Separate setting function for acceleration and deceleration ■ Home return function using sensor and Z phase ■ 24/32-bit counters, 2 for each axis ■ Capable of counting encoder signals and output pulses ■ 12 general-purpose I/O points, with direction switching and logical switching for each terminal ■ Can switch to manual pulse input --------------------------------------------- *This product was discontinued for manufacturing and sales at the end of March 2015. ---------------------------------------------
